well, for starters...music is my life. I started playing the clarinet at age 10 and still play it and love it. I started playing piano when i was 14 and am a self taught pianist and singer since age 15. Was a rapper from age 12- 14 but it wasn't me...i began writing full songs when i was 15 or 16, and continue writing because i have to. hope u like!
